Under Sink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small puddle under sink | Yes | No | You can likely handle it yourself with a towel and some basic cleaning supplies. |
| Burst pipe in wall | No | Yes | You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ively extract water and repair the pipe. |
| Water damage in multiple rooms | No | Yes | You’ll need a team of professionals to quickly and efficiently extract water, dry, and restore your home.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ls or ceilings | No | Yes | You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air hidden water damage. |
| Large flood or significant water damage | No | Yes | You’ll need a team of professionals to quickly and efficiently extract water, dry, and restore your home. |
| Water damage in a historic or unique home | No | Yes | You’ll need a team of professionals with expertise in restoring unique or historic homes. |

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Fort Washington, MD
The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ction in Fort Washington, MD,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Don’t worry about the cost don’t stress about the process and don’t wait for it to get worse.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s |
| Insurance Claims Processing | $0 – $1,000 | Complexity of claims process, documentation required, and communication with insurance company |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ural repairs) | $1,000 – $10,000 |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s |
